Easy to Fold

Many electric scooters fold into a compact size that is easy to carry. The EV Rider Transport AF automatic folding scooter, for example it folds down at the touch of the remote control. This makes it simple to fit the scooter in the back of a vehicle and take it on trips outside of town. It also reduces the space at home and makes it easier to keep the scooter in good condition and ready for use.

The process is initiated by pressing a button on the remote. The scooter's battery will power the process, meaning you don't have to apply any effort to get it started. After a short amount of time the scooter is fully restored to its original shape and ready for another trip.

Auto-folding scooters are a real lifesaver for anyone who needs to get around but is unable to lift heavy objects or having to bend down to reach small controls. It is essential to know how the scooter functions prior to making use of it for long durations of time. The user manual should provide you with an in-depth explanation of how the scooter folds and unfolds and it's recommended to be familiar with any buttons or levers involved.

If you're having difficulty folding the scooter or unfold, make sure that the battery is charged and that nothing is preventing it from working. If you're still having issues then read the troubleshooting section of the manual to discover solutions.

Maintenance for the scooter that folds automatically is the same as maintenance for any other type of mobility scooter. You will need to regularly examine the motor, tire and other mechanical components for signs of wear and tear. The battery is an essential element for the scooter to operate so it is essential to keep it fully charged and clean. Cleaning the battery frequently with an abrasive or rag can ensure it will last longer and perform better.

Easy to Transport

Many electric  automatic folding mobility scooter s come with advanced mechanisms that allow them to fold down and compactly with little effort. This makes it easy to transport and store them in small spaces similar to a trunk of a car. This feature is especially useful for people who travel long distances frequently or have weak muscles in the hands.

When looking for a fold-away scooter that autofolds it is essential to consider the overall size, width, and length of the unit when it is folded and unfolded. This will ensure that you are able to transport the scooter with ease and it will be able to fit into any location you plan to use it. It is also important to be aware of the maximum speed at which the scooter can travel at one charge, as well as any other essential specifications like armrests and battery life.



In addition to being easy to transport, most auto-folding scooters weigh less and are smaller than traditional mobility scooters. They are easy to maneuver and carry, particularly for those who have less strength in the arms or hands. Some models, like the Enhance Mobility Transformer or EV Rider Transport AF Plus can be reduced to a size small enough to fit on an airplane.

One of the best features of automatic folding scooters is that the button can be hit on the control panel to fold or unfold it. This eliminates the need to use a separate remote, which makes them useful for those with weak hand strength. Some models come with an integrated remote control that can operate the lights or other functions. This is beneficial for those with limited hand strength.

One drawback of auto-folding scooters is that they're not ideal for very rough or uneven terrain. They are made for smooth sidewalks and indoor spaces, which means they will struggle on more difficult surfaces. If you're concerned about this, you should purchase a robust model with large wheels for more comfort and stability.

Easy to maintain

To ensure that your electric automatic folding 4-wheel mobility scooter working well for many years to come It is recommended to perform regular maintenance checks. Some of these can be completed by yourself, while others require the services of a professional. The routine maintenance checks should include checking and tightening all connections, as well as cleaning the structural and mechanical components of the scooter.

It is also important to store your scooter in a cool, dry location when not in use. Extreme temperatures may affect the performance and battery life of your scooter. Storing your scooter in direct sunlight can cause damage to its components, causing them wear out prematurely. To prevent this from happening, you can cover your scooter with an enclosure for storage and store your scooter in the garage or shed.

A regular inspection and examination of the batteries is an important aspect to maintain your scooter.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for charging and storing your scooter's battery, and avoid overcharging. Also, consider purchasing a battery charger that is specifically designed for your scooter's model. This will ensure your batteries are fully charged prior to every use and maximize their lifespan. If your battery isn't holding a charge or is showing signs of wear, it's better to replace it as soon as you notice signs of wear.

Inspect the tires of your scooter to make sure they are in good shape and not damaged. A properly inflated wheel will give you a more comfort and stability. They will also increase the lifespan of the tire. Lubricating the moving parts of your scooter is recommended to prevent them from becoming stiff and creaking.

Check for any unusual sounds coming from your scooter for any unusual sounds coming from it. These sounds could be a sign of a problem with the structure or mechanics of your scooter parts, which should be taken care of immediately. Strange sounds such as grinding, whirring, or clicking may indicate that parts are loose or damaged and need to be repaired or replaced.
